分布式系统在物联网(IoT)边缘节点的应用,是实现高效、稳定、安全物联网架构的关键。以下将从多个角度揭秘分布式系统在物联网边缘节点中的关键作用。
一、数据处理与存储的分布式优化
1.1 实时数据处理能力
物联网设备产生的大量数据需要在边缘节点进行实时处理。分布式系统通过在多个节点上分配数据处理任务,实现了并行处理,提高了数据处理的速度和效率。
1.2 数据存储的分布式架构
分布式系统采用分布式存储架构,将数据存储在多个节点上,提高了数据存储的可靠性和可扩展性。当单个节点发生故障时,其他节点可以接管其工作,保证数据不丢失。
二、网络通信的分布式优化
2.1 分布式网络拓扑结构
分布式系统通过构建分布式网络拓扑结构,提高了网络的可靠性和容错性。在边缘节点间形成冗余路径,确保了数据传输的稳定性。
2.2 分布式路由算法
分布式路由算法可以根据网络状态动态调整数据传输路径,优化网络带宽利用率,降低数据传输延迟。
三、边缘计算与云计算的协同
3.1 边缘计算与云计算的优势互补
分布式系统将边缘计算与云计算相结合,实现了计算资源的优势互补。在边缘节点进行实时数据处理,减轻了云计算中心的负担,提高了整体系统的响应速度。
3.2 分布式任务调度
分布式系统通过分布式任务调度,将计算任务合理分配到边缘节点和云计算中心,实现了资源的合理利用。
四、安全性与隐私保护
4.1 分布式安全架构
分布式系统采用分布式安全架构,实现了安全性的横向扩展。通过在多个节点上部署安全策略,提高了整体系统的安全性。
4.2 分布式加密与认证
分布式系统采用分布式加密与认证机制,保障了数据在传输和存储过程中的安全性。通过分布式密钥管理,提高了密钥的安全性。
五、应用场景
5.1 工业物联网
在工业物联网中,分布式系统在边缘节点中的应用可以实现实时监控、预测性维护和智能化生产。
5.2 智能交通
在智能交通领域,分布式系统在边缘节点中的应用可以实现实时路况监测、自动驾驶辅助决策等功能。
5.3 智能家居
在智能家居领域,分布式系统在边缘节点中的应用可以实现设备协同、家庭安全监控等功能。
六、总结
分布式系统在物联网边缘节点中的关键作用主要体现在数据处理与存储优化、网络通信优化、边缘计算与云计算协同、安全性与隐私保护等方面。随着物联网技术的不断发展,分布式系统在物联网边缘节点中的应用将更加广泛,为物联网应用提供更加高效、稳定、安全的基础设施。